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of steel structure docking technology, and in particular to a steel structure docking device for steel structure construction. Background Technology

[0002] In the application of steel structures, it is often necessary to weld adjacent steel structures together to form a stable whole. During welding, the steel structure needs to be secured first, requiring the use of clamping devices to prevent shaking during welding.

[0003] A search revealed that Chinese Patent Publication No. CN221891280U discloses a steel structure docking device for steel structure construction, including a No. 1 steel structure, a No. 2 steel structure set on the right side of the No. 1 steel structure, clamping plates set on the front and rear sides of the No. 1 and No. 2 steel structures, a rectangular block fixedly installed at the lower end of the clamping plate, and a bidirectional electric push rod fixedly connected between the rectangular blocks on the front and rear sides.

[0004] While the above solution reduces the workload of workers adjusting the position of the steel structure, in actual use, the method of clamping the steel structure by moving the front and rear clamping plates simultaneously with the bidirectional electric actuator can easily lead to misalignment of the two steel structures when they are joined due to slight differences in the installation of the two structures. This makes it inconvenient to make fine adjustments and affects the welding effect.

[0005] Therefore, there is an urgent need to provide a steel structure docking device for steel structure construction to solve the above problems. Utility Model Content

[0006] The technical problem to be solved by this utility model is to overcome the shortcomings of the existing technology, which uses only bidirectional electric actuators to drive the front and rear clamping plates to move simultaneously to clamp the steel structure in actual use. Due to the slight differences in the installation of the two structures, the two steel structures are prone to misalignment when they are joined, making it inconvenient to make fine adjustments and affecting the welding effect. This utility model provides a steel structure joining device for steel structure construction.

[0029] The preferred embodiments of the present invention will now be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ings, so that the advantages and features of the present invention can be more easily understood by those skilled in the art, thereby making a clearer and more definite definition of the scope of protection of the present invention.

[0030] Please see Figures 1-4 A steel structure docking device for steel structure construction, including a base 1, and further comprising:

[0031] Support plate 2 is provided on the top of the base 1, and the support plate 2 is welded to the top edge of the base 1.

[0032] L-shaped plate 3, each support plate 2 has an L-shaped plate 3 movably installed on its side;

[0033] Adjustment component 4 is located on the top of L-shaped plate 3. Adjustment component 4 is used to fine-tune the position of the steel structure to prevent misalignment of the steel structure.

[0034] The adjustment assembly 4 includes a displacement seat 41 disposed on the top of the L-shaped plate 3, a moving unit 42 disposed between the displacement seat 41 and the L-shaped plate 3, a lifting plate 43 disposed on the top of the displacement seat 41, and a lifting unit 44 disposed at the bottom of the lifting plate 43. The moving unit 42 is used to adjust the horizontal position of the lifting plate 43, and the lifting unit 44 is used to adjust the vertical position of the lifting plate 43.

[0035] A connecting unit 45 is provided between the two L-shaped plates 3.

[0036] The L-shaped plate 3 has a rotating shaft 31 installed on its side. The rotating shaft 31 is movably connected to the side wall of the support plate 2, and the rotating shaft 31 has a rotating component 46 on its side. Preferably, the rotating component 46 is a rotary cylinder. The rotating shaft 31 is rotatably connected to the side wall of the support plate 2.

[0037] Among them, the top surface of the L-shaped plate 3 is provided with a groove, and the displacement seat 41 is movably disposed inside the groove;

[0038] The moving unit 42 includes a threaded hole provided at the bottom side of the displacement seat 41, a threaded rod 421 movably provided inside the threaded hole, a guide rod 422 provided on the outer side of the threaded rod 421, a guide hole provided on the side of the displacement seat 41 that matches the longitudinal cross-sectional dimensions of the guide rod 422, the threaded rod 421 being rotatably connected to the side wall of the L-shaped plate 3, and the guide rod 422 being welded to the side wall of the groove of the L-shaped plate 3.

[0039] The inner wall of the displacement seat 41 is provided with a sliding groove, and the lifting plate 43 is movably disposed inside the sliding groove.

[0040] The lifting unit 44 includes a bidirectional lead screw 441 movably connected to the inner wall of the displacement seat 41, a sliding sleeve 442 disposed opposite to the outside of the bidirectional lead screw 441, and a movable rod 443 movably connected between the sliding sleeve 442 and the lifting plate 43. Preferably, the sliding sleeve 442 is threadedly connected to the bidirectional lead screw 441.

[0041] The connecting unit 45 includes a fixed shell 451 fixedly connected to the bottom of one of the L-shaped plates 3, one end of an extrusion member 452 fixedly connected to the inner wall of the fixed shell 451, and one end of a limiting frame 453 fixedly connected to the other end of the extrusion member 452. A limiting frame 454 is provided on the outer side of the other end of the limiting frame 453. The limiting frame 454 is fixedly connected to the bottom of the other L-shaped plate 3. Preferably, the extrusion member 452 is a compression spring. A movable groove is provided on the side wall of the fixed shell 451. A push block is movably arranged inside the movable groove. The push block is installed on the outer side of the limiting frame 453.

[0042] The adjustment assembly 4 also includes a clamping unit 47 disposed on the top of the lifting plate 43;

[0043] The clamping unit 47 includes a first clamping plate 471 and a second clamping plate 472 disposed opposite to each other on the top of the lifting plate 43, and a pusher 473 disposed on the side of the first clamping plate 471 or the second clamping plate 472. Preferably, the pusher 473 is a cylinder. Rubber pads are fixedly connected to the opposite sides of the first clamping plate 471 and the second clamping plate 472.

[0044] In use, the two steel structures to be joined are first placed on top of two lifting plates 43, with one end of each steel structure abutting against each other. The opposing pushers 473 then drive the first clamping plate 471 and the second clamping plate 472 to move relative to each other, clamping the steel structures. Next, by rotating the threaded rod 421, the displacement seat 41 slides along the length of the guide rod 422 under the action of the threaded pair. The sliding of the displacement seat 41 adjusts the lateral position of the lifting plate 43. Then, by rotating the bidirectional screw 441, the two sliding sleeves 442 move relative to each other along the outer side of the bidirectional screw 441 under the action of the threaded pair. This causes the lifting plate 43 to rise or fall via the movable rod 443, adjusting its height and thus the lateral and longitudinal positions of the steel structures. This ensures precise alignment of the two steel structures for subsequent welding work.

[0045] During welding, the elastic pressing action of the extrusion member 452 pushes the limiting frame 453 so that one end of it engages with the limiting frame 454, thereby fixing the two L-shaped plates 3 in place. Then, the rotating member 46 drives the rotating shaft 31 to rotate, thereby rotating the two L-shaped plates 3 and adjusting the welding position of the two steel structures in real time for welding.
